Microsoft

Research Intern - Computer Vision Algorithms

United States, Washington, Redmond

Found: Today

This internship is based in Redmond, Washington, requiring in-office presence 3 days a week.

Compensation:

USD $6,710 - $13,270 per month

Responsibilities:

Collaborate with researchers on developing match-free algorithms for geometric computer vision problems, implement and benchmark algorithms.

Qualifications:

  • Currently enrolled in a PhD program in Mathematics, Computer Science, or related STEM field.
  • Knowledge of probability theory and statistics, proficiency in Python or C++.
